As expected, Ahuntsic came out with guns blazing, but we were able to keep it close because our big man Kazadi Nyanguila (left) and guard Lenny Austin (right) were scoring at will. We trailed 23-19 after the first quarter. Early on in the 2nd frame, both Kazadi and Lenny picked up their second fouls, and we had to put them on the bench, which allowed Ahuntsic to extend their lead, and we trailed 44-35 at halftime.
Everything went Ahuntsic’s way for most of the 3rd quarter, and they led by 19 with 2 minutes remaining in that period. After using our 2nd time out of the half, we went on a run to close the gap to 11 heading into the final period. We continued to cut into the lead in the 4th quarter, and tied the game with 1:15 remaining. We led by 1 with 4 seconds left with our guard Jonathan Bermillo at the foul line. He made both shots (he was 9/9 in the game) and we thought we had the game won. Not so fast ! Ahuntsic made a desperation shot from beyond half court at the buzzer, sending the game into overtime.
The shot created pandemonium, as both Ahuntsic’s bench and the fans stormed the court. Our guys were able to keep their composure, and once order was restored, we scored the first 4 points in overtime. We eventually built up a 7-point lead, and finally won 103-100.
Kareem Jackson (left) had a monster game with 29 points, 17 rebounds and 4 assists. Lenny Austin had his typical strong performance with 18 points, 7 assists and 3 steals. Jonathan Bermillo (right) was tremendous, taking over the game in the 4th quarter and finishing with 21 points. Kazadi Nyanguila had 13 points and 9 rebounds before fouling out. Seth Amoah and Ben Millaud added 10 points each.
